Abstract
BACKGROUND: Hematologic and biochemical reference intervals depend on many factors, including age. A review of the literature highlights the lack of reference intervals for 6-wk-old specific pathogen free (SPF) Hampshire-Yorkshire crossbred pigs. For translational research, 6-wk-old pigs represent an important animal model for both human juvenile colitis and diabetes mellitus type 2 given the similarities between the porcine and human gastrointestinal maturation process. The aim of this study was to determine reference intervals for hematological and biochemical parameters in healthy 6-wk-old crossbred pigs. Blood samples were collected from 66 clinically healthy Hampshire-Yorkshire pigs. The pigs were 6 wks old, represented both sexes, and were housed in a SPF facility. Automated hematological and biochemical analysis were performed using an ADVIA 120 Hematology System and a Cobas 6000 C501 Clinical Chemistry Analyzer.Entities:

Methods of clinical analysis
| Anion gap | Calculated | |
| Sodium | ISE, diluted | Potentiometry* |
| Potassium | ISE, diluted | Potentiometry* |
| Chloride | ISE, diluted | Potentiometry* |
| Bicarbonate | PEPC/NADH-NAD+ | Zero-order kinetic* |
| Inorganic phosphate | Phosphomolybdate/UV 340 nm | Endpoint* |
| Calcium | Schwarzenbach/UV 600 nm | Endpoint* |
| Urea nitrogen | Enzymatic: urease with GLDH | First-order kinetic* |
| Creatinine | Jaffe | First-order kinetic* |
| Glucose | Hexokinase | Endpoint* |
| Total protein | Biuret | Endpoint* |
| Albumin | Bromocresol green | Endpoint* |
| Globulin | Calculated | |
| AST | Modified IFCC | Zero-order kinetic* |
| Creatine kinase | Modified IFCC | Zero-order kinetic* |
| Alkaline phosphatase | Modified IFCC | Zero-order kinetic* |
| GGT | Modified IFCC | Zero-order kinetic* |
| Bilirubin total | Diazo | Endpoint* |
| SDH-37 | D-Fructose to D-Sorbitol/NADH/UV 340 nm | Zero-order kinetic |
All analysis were carried out at 37°C.
AST, aspartate aminotransferase; GGT, γ-glutamyltransferase; SDH-37, sorbitol dehydrogenase; IFCC, International Federation of Clinical Chemistry; ISE, Ion specific electrode.
*Roche Diagnostics GmbH.
Hematologic and clinical biochemical reference intervals for 6-week-old Hampshire-Yorkshire pigs between 10–20 kg
| RBC | m/uL | 66 | 7.31 | 7.33 | 5.84 | 9.04 | 5.52 - 9.11 | Non-Gaussian |
| HGB | gm/dL | 65 | 10.7 | 10.8 | 8.6 | 12.8 | 8.8 - 12.7 | Gaussian |
| HTC | % | 66 | 35.5 | 35.7 | 25.4 | 43.8 | 28.3 - 42.7 | Gaussian |
| MCV | fL | 66 | 48.9 | 49.8 | 37.7 | 59.1 | 38.4 - 59.3 | Gaussian |
| MCH | pgm | 66 | 14.8 | 15.3 | 11.1 | 18.3 | 11.1 - 18.4 | Non-Gaussian |
| MCHC | gm/dL | 66 | 30.2 | 30.3 | 27.3 | 32.4 | 27.9 - 32.4 | Gaussian |
| RDW | % | 54 | 24.4 | 24.5 | 16.1 | 33.3 | 16.4 - 32.3 | Gaussian |
| WBC | /μL | 66 | 15,315 | 14,735 | 5,650 | 26,470 | 5,443 - 25,186 | Gaussian |
| Neutrophils | /μL | 66 | 5,668 | 5,266.5 | 1,192 | 15,745 | 810 - 13,397 | Gaussian with square root transformation |
| Lymphocytes | /μL | 66 | 8,677 | 8,239 | 4,045 | 15,856 | 3,810 - 14,919 | Gaussian with square root transformation |
| Monocytes | /μL | 66 | 692 | 619 | 237 | 1,460 | 219 - 1,705 | Gaussian with logarithmic transformation |
| Eosinophils | /μL | 64 | 219 | 201.5 | 58 | 574 | 45 - 481 | Gaussian with square root transformation |
| Basophils | /μL | 64 | 53 | 43 | 11 | 151 | 14 - 146 | Gaussian with logarithmic transformation |
| Platelets | /μL | 66 | 540,773 | 545,500 | 138,000 | 909,000 | 208,588 - 872,957 | Gaussian |
| Anion gap | mmol/L | 63 | 21 | 20 | 13 | 31 | 14 - 29 | Gaussian with logarithmic transformation |
| Sodium | mmol/L | 63 | 141 | 140 | 125 | 159 | 131 - 151 | Non-Gaussian |
| Potassium | mmol/L | 62 | 4.9 | 4.8 | 3.7 | 6.3 | 3.7 - 6.1 | Gaussian with square root transformation |
| Chloride | mmol/L | 63 | 100 | 100 | 90 | 112 | 93 - 108 | Non-Gaussian |
| Bicarbonate | mmol/L | 63 | 25 | 25 | 17 | 31 | 19 - 31 | Gaussian |
| Phosphorus | mg/dL | 63 | 8.9 | 8.8 | 6.1 | 12.3 | 6.3 - 11.5 | Gaussian |
| Calcium | mg/dL | 63 | 11.2 | 11.2 | 9.7 | 12.8 | 9.9 - 12.5 | Gaussian |
| BUN | mg/dL | 63 | 10 | 10 | 4 | 21 | 4 - 18 | Gaussian with square root transformation |
| Creatinine | mg/dL | 63 | 0.8 | 0.8 | 0.5 | 1.1 | 0.5 - 1.1 | Non-Gaussian |
| Glucose | mg/dL | 61 | 106 | 105 | 70 | 139 | 75 - 136 | Gaussian |
| Total protein | g/dL | 63 | 4.9 | 4.9 | 4.1 | 5.9 | 4.0 - 5.8 | Gaussian |
| Albumin | g/dL | 63 | 3.9 | 3.9 | 3.2 | 4.7 | 3.1 - 4.8 | Non-Gaussian |
| Globulin | g/dL | 63 | 1.0 | 0.9 | 0.2 | 1.8 | 0.3 - 1.7 | Gaussian |
| AST | IU/L | 63 | 44 | 36 | 13 | 141 | 13 - 111 | Gaussian with logarithmic transformation |
| Creatine kinase | IU/L | 62 | 1,358 | 921 | 170 | 6,823 | 153 - 5,427 | Gaussian with logarithmic transformation |
| Alkaline phosphatase | IU/L | 63 | 297 | 280 | 135 | 603 | 130 - 513 | Gaussian with square root transformation |
| GGT | IU/L | 63 | 57 | 55 | 34 | 112 | 33 - 94 | Gaussian with logarithmic transformation |
| Total bilirubin | mg/dL | 63 | 0.1 | 0.1 | 0 | 0.4 | 0 - 0.2 | Non-Gaussian |
| SDH-37 | IU/L | 63 | 0.5 | 0 | 0 | 4 | 0 - 1.7 | Non-Gaussian |
RBC, red blood cells; HGB, hemoglobin; HTC, hematocrit; MCV, mean corpuscular volume; MCHC, mean corpuscular hemoglobin concentration; RDW, erythrocyte distribution width; WBC, white blood cells; BUN, blood urea nitrogen; AST, aspartate aminotransferase; GGT, γ-glutamyltransferase; SDH-37,sorbitol dehydrogenase.
